GND (Pin 1): Ground. Connect to V for single supply
operation.
V (Pin 2): Negative Supply. Connect to ground for single
supply operation. Potential should be more negative than
GND.
IN + (Pin 3): Noninverting Comparator Input. Input com-
mon mode range from V to V + –1.3V. Input current
typically 10pA at 25
°C.
IN (Pin 4): Inverting Comparator Input. Input common
mode range from V to V + –1.3V. Input current typically
10pA at 25
°C.
HYST (Pin 5): Hysteresis Input. Connect to REF if not
used. Input voltage range is from VREF to VREF – 50mV.
REF (Pin 6): Reference Output. 1.182V with respect
to V . Can source up to 200
µA and sink 15µA at 25°C.
Drive 0.01
µF bypass capacitor without oscillation.
V + (Pin 7): Positive Supply. 2V to 11V.
OUT (Pin 8): Comparator CMOS Output. Swings from
GND to V +. Output can source up to 40mA and sink 5mA.
LTC1441
OUT A (Pin 1): Comparator A CMOS Output. Swings from
V to V +. Output can source up to 40mA and sink 5mA.
V (Pin 2): Negative Supply.
IN A+ (Pin 3): Noninverting Input of Comparator A. Input
common mode range from V to V + –1.3V. Input current
typically 10pA at 25
°C.
IN A(Pin 4): Inverting Input of Comparator A. Input
common mode range from V to V + –1.3V. Input current
typically 10pA at 25
°C.
IN B (Pin 5): Inverting Input of Comparator B. Input
common mode range from V to V + –1.3V. Input current
typically 10pA at 25
°C.
IN B + (Pin 6): Noninverting Input of Comparator B. Input
common mode range from V to V + –1.3V. Input current
typically 10pA at 25
°C.
V + (Pin 7): Positive Supply. 2V to 11V.
OUT B (Pin 8): Comparator B CMOS Output. Swings from
V to V +. Output can source up to 40mA and sink 5mA.
LTC1442
OUT A (Pin 1): Comparator A CMOS Output. Swings from
V to V +. Output can source up to 40mA and sink 5mA.
V (Pin 2): Negative Supply.
IN A+ (Pin 3): Noninverting Input of Comparator A. Input
common mode range from V to V + –1.3V. Input current
typically 10pA at 25
°C.
IN B(Pin 4): Inverting Input of Comparator B. Input
common mode range from V to V + –1.3V. Input current
typically 10pA at 25
°C.
HYST (Pin 5): Hysteresis Input. Connect to REF if not
used. Input voltage range is from VREF to VREF – 50mV.
REF (Pin 6): Reference Output. 1.182V with respect
to V . Can source up to 200
µA and sink 15µA at 25°C.
Drive 0.01
µF bypass capacitor without oscillation.
V + (Pin 7): Positive Supply. 2V to 11V.
OUT B (Pin 8): Comparator B CMOS Output. Swings from
V to V +. Output can source up to 40mA and sink 5mA.
